MOOG is an astronomical software package. It is an example of Fortran code that performs a variety of spectral line analysis and spectrum synthesis tasks under the assumption of local thermodynamic equilibrium. Moog uses a model photosphere together with a list of atomic or molecular transitions to generate an emergent spectrum by solving the equation of radiative transfer.
The typical use of MOOG is to assist in the determination of the chemical composition of a star, e.g. Sneden (1973). This paper contains also the description of the first version of the code and has been cited about 240 times as of 2008-04-24 by publications in international journals studying the abundances of chemical elements in stars.
The software package has been developed and is maintained by Christopher Sneden, University of Texas at Austin. The current supported version of the code was released in August 2010 and is described in the MOOG User's Guide (see references below). Moog is written in FORTRAN 77.
In statistics and coding theory, a Hamming space is usually the set of all binary strings of length N. It is used in the theory of coding signals and transmission.
More generally, a Hamming space can be defined over any alphabet (set) Q as the set of words of a fixed length N with letters from Q. If Q is a finite field, then a Hamming space over Q is an N-dimensional vector space over Q. In the typical, binary case, the field is thus GF(2) (also denoted by Z2).
In coding theory, if Q has q elements, then any subset C (usually assumed of cardinality at least two) of the N-dimensional Hamming space over Q is called a q-ary code of length N; the elements of C are called codewords. In the case where C is a linear subspace of its Hamming space, it is called a linear code. A typical example of linear code is the Hamming code. Codes defined via a Hamming space necessarily have the same length for every codeword, so they are called block codes when it is necessary to distinguish them from variable-length codes that are defined by unique factorization on a monoid.
Code (stylized as C O D E) is an album by British electronic band Cabaret Voltaire. The track "Don't Argue" was released as a single, as was "Here To Go".
The lyrics (and title) of "Don't Argue" incorporate verbatim a number of sentences from the narration of the 1945 short film Your Job in Germany, directed by Frank Capra. The film was aimed at American soldiers occupying Germany and strongly warned against trusting or fraternizing with German citizens.
A code is a type of legislation that purports to exhaustively cover a complete system of laws or a particular area of law as it existed at the time the code was enacted, by a process of codification. Though the process and motivations for codification are similar in different common law and civil law systems, their usage is different. In a civil law country, a Code typically exhaustively covers the complete system of law, such as civil law or criminal law. By contrast, in a common law country with legislative practices in the English tradition, a Code is a less common form of legislation, which differs from usual legislation that, when enacted, modify the existing common law only to the extent of its express or implicit provision, but otherwise leaves the common law intact. By contrast, a code entirely replaces the common law in a particular area, leaving the common law inoperative unless and until the code is repealed. In a third case of slightly different usage, in the United States and other common law countries that have adopted similar legislative practices, a Code is a standing body of statute law on a particular area, which is added to, subtracted from, or otherwise modified by individual legislative enactments.

Moog is a 2004 documentary film by Hans Fjellestad about electronic instrument pioneer Dr. Robert Moog. The film features scenes of Dr. Moog interacting with various musical artists who view Moog as an influential figure in the history of electronic music.
Moog is not a comprehensive history of electronic music nor does it serve as a chronological history of the development of the Moog synthesizer. There is no narration, rather the scenes feature candid conversation and interviews that serve more as a tribute to Moog than a documentary.
The film was shot on location in Hollywood, New York, Tokyo, and Asheville, North Carolina where Moog's company is based. Additional concert performances were filmed in London and San Francisco.
The film's 2004 release was designed to coincide with the fiftieth anniversary of Moog Music, Robert Moog's company that was founded as R.A. Moog Co. in 1954.
